Origin & Meaning

AI-Written
Derived from the Greek name Penelopeia, traditionally associated with pēnelops, a type of mottled duck, or pēnē, referring to a weaver's thread. Homer gave it enduring life through the steadfast queen of Ithaca in the Odyssey. In America, it lived quietly in double-digit annual tallies for over a century before undergoing an unprecedented climb after 2000.
